GenJet™ DNA In Vitro Tranfection Reagent for SHEP is pre-optimized for transfecting SHEP cells. This human neuroblastoma cell line was cloned from a single primary tumor. Unlike other neuroblastoma cell, SHEP cells does not produce IGF-II, expresses five-fold fewer IGF-IRs than SH-SY5Y and dies in serum-free media or following exposure to metabolic stressors. 

Refer to the following optimal transfection conditions for maximal transfection efficiency on SHEP
 cells. GenJet™ reagent, 1.0 ml, is sufficient for 300 to 600 transfections in 24 well plates or 50 to 100 transfections in 6 well plates.

Storage Condition
Store at 4 °C. If stored properly, the product is stable for 12 months or longer
